What's Window Glazing?

Window glazing refers back to the glass element installed within a window body. The expression may explain the whole process of fitting glass right into a window frame. In the construction and residential enhancement industries, glazing commonly refers to the quantity of glass panes used in a window and the technologies placed on boost performance.

Modern day glazing methods are intended to boost insulation, lower energy intake, boost stability, and maximize indoor ease and comfort. Depending upon the type of glazing made use of, Home windows can significantly impression a constructing's thermal efficiency and Total energy fees.

Different types of Window Glazing

There are numerous kinds of window glazing accessible, Just about every supplying diverse levels of performance and Positive aspects.

Solitary Glazing

One glazing is made of just one pane of glass in just a window frame. This was the standard possibility in older buildings and homes. Whilst one-glazed windows allow for an abundance of normal light, they supply restricted insulation and they are a lot less successful at reducing sound and preventing warmth loss.

Double Glazing

Double glazing is among the most popular window alternatives these days. It capabilities two panes of glass separated by a sealed hole filled with air or an insulating gasoline which include argon. This structure generates a thermal barrier that helps manage indoor temperatures and improves Vitality efficiency.

Double-glazed Home windows give many Rewards, which includes:

Decreased warmth loss through Winter season
Improved cooling performance in the course of summer months
Greater seem insulation
Lowered condensation
Elevated house price
Triple Glazing

Triple glazing consists of three panes of glass with two insulating gaps among them. This sort of glazing offers even better thermal general performance and noise reduction than double glazing. It is commonly used in locations with very cold climates the place maximizing insulation is often a precedence.

While triple glazing is dearer, it can offer extended-expression Electricity price savings and enhanced ease and comfort.

Low-Emissivity (Minimal-E) Glazing

Lower-E glazing encompasses a special microscopic coating that reflects heat while enabling purely natural light-weight to go through. During Winter season, the coating will help retain indoor warmth from escaping. Through summertime, it could possibly lower heat entering the setting up.

Very low-E glass is broadly used in energy-efficient households because it increases insulation without compromising visibility or organic light.

Laminated Glazing

Laminated glazing is made of two or more glass layers bonded along with a plastic interlayer. This sort of glazing is known for its security and security Advantages. In the event the glass breaks, the fragments continue being connected into the interlayer rather than shattering into risky pieces.

Laminated glazing is commonly used in:

Schools
Commercial properties
Protection-sensitive destinations
Houses in storm-inclined spots
Tempered Glazing

Tempered glass is heat-addressed to raise its toughness. When damaged, it shatters into compact, fewer destructive parts rather than sharp shards. This causes it to be a popular choice for doorways, significant Home windows, and locations in which basic safety is a priority.

Benefits of Window Glazing

Modern window glazing presents various advantages for homeowners and organizations.

Enhanced Energy Performance

One of the greatest great things about window glazing is enhanced thermal insulation. Higher-efficiency glazing decreases heat transfer, serving to manage a cushty indoor temperature All year long. Because of this, heating and cooling programs work much less, resulting in lower Electrical power costs.

Improved Comfort and ease

Proper glazing minimizes drafts and cold spots near Home windows. It can help make a a lot more secure indoor surroundings, building residing and dealing spaces extra comfy.

Noise Reduction

Double and triple-glazed windows considerably lessen outside the house noise. This is especially advantageous for Houses Found close to chaotic roadways, airports, or urban places.

Increased Safety

Highly developed glazing possibilities such as laminated and tempered glass supply additional safety in opposition to crack-ins and accidental hurt. More robust glass will make it harder for intruders to achieve entry.

Lessened Condensation

Condensation takes place when heat indoor air will come into connection with a chilly glass floor. Present day glazing units lessen this concern by preserving warmer glass temperatures, aiding prevent dampness buildup and mold advancement.

Environmental Benefits

Strength-effective glazing can help decrease All round Power consumption, decreasing carbon emissions and supporting environmental sustainability. Numerous homeowners choose large-performance glazing as component of their efforts to make eco-pleasant households.

Deciding on the Ideal Window Glazing

Selecting the right glazing alternative is determined by numerous variables, such as local climate, budget, Strength efficiency aims, and sound reduction necessities.

For moderate climates, double glazing frequently offers a superb equilibrium involving Value and general performance. In colder regions, triple glazing may supply increased extended-time period savings. Homeowners worried about safety may perhaps like laminated glazing, while Individuals focused on maximizing Electrical power efficiency normally select Low-E glass.

Consulting with knowledgeable window installer might help ascertain the most fitted glazing Answer for a particular property.
